November 18, 2003 (TUESDAY) “PROVMAR TERMINAL AND PROVMAR TERMINAL II” OF “PROVMAR FUELS” (BOTH VESSEL’S HOME PORT IS HAMILTON) AT THEIR PERMANENT BERTHS AT PIER # 23 (PROVMAR FUELS TERMINAL IN HAMILTON). PHOTOS TAKEN BETWEEN 8:38 AND 8:55 AM.

PROVMAR TERMINAL/Official Number 0345867/Year Built 1959/Former Name UNGAVA TRANSPORT/Port of Registry HAMILTON /IMO 5376521/Vessel Type BARGE - OIL TANK /GT 4,710.36 t/NT 4,631.11 t/Length 117.41 m/Breadth 16.92 m/ Depth 7.80 m/Propulsion Type NON-PROPELLED/Builder SARPSBORG, MEK, VERKSTAD GREAKER,NORWAY/Owner PROVMAR FUELS INC.,HAMILTON, ONTARIO,CANADA

PROVMAR TERMINAL II /Official Number 0173217/Year Built 1948/Year Rebuilt 1954/Former Name IMPERIAL SARNIA/Port of Registry HAMILTON/IMO 5159600/Vessel Type TANKER - OIL/PRODUCT/GT 4,947.02 t/NT 3,100.94 t/Length 120.24 m/Breadth 16.15 m/Depth 7.96 m/Engine STEAM TURBINE/Speed (knots) 12.0/Propulsion Power 2900 SHP/Builder COLLINGWOOD SHIPYARDS LTD.,COLLINGWOOD, ONTARIO,CANADA/Owner PROVMAR FUELS INC.,HAMILTON, ONTARIO,CANADA
